Is Acupuncture safe and painless?

Acupuncture is extremely safe. It is a "drug-free" therapy, yielding no side effects except feelings of relaxation and being grounded. For your safety, only sterile and disposable acupuncture needles are used. These pre-packaged needles are only used once and disposed of after each use.

While most people express fear or anxiety of needles before their first visit, they are surprised by the pleasantness of the acupuncture treatment. Unlike hollow hypodermic needles used for injections, acupuncture needles are solid throughout and are very fine, about the thickness of a human hair. There should be very little or no discomfort with needle insertion. The typical description includes feeling a slight pinch or pressure. You may then feel a slight sensation as the needle contacts the Qi. This is called the “De Qi" sensation. (This is how acupuncturists engage the Qi in your body in order to help balance it.) This sensation can vary from a vague numbness or heaviness to a tingling or dull ache. Sometimes you may experience the sensation of energy or warmth spreading from the needle. In some instances the sensation travels along the path of the meridian and can affect whole areas of the body or limbs. All of these reactions are a good sign that the treatment is working. There is  no marking on the skin after the needles are removed. We take great care to ensure that you are very comfortable so that you can relax while the needles are in place. The more you can relax during an acupuncture treatment, the better the results. Many people experience a deep sense of release and relaxation during and at the end of the acupuncture treatment.
